Okay..a real quick question here.
My starter just went dead on my 97 jeep wrangler, I got a heavier duty
one (A mean green) but the problem i am having is that the wiring is
different. The wiring to attach to the starter is not two wires..well
it is..but its that the two wires are molded together using ruber or
latex.And the orientation on the stock motor is so that both terminals
are vertical and accordingly, the wiring "boot" is oriented so that it
will only fit that way. Now, on the new motor, one terminal is vertical
but the other is horizontal. So, i need to know if i should just try
and serperate the two wires by just cutting the boot or if there are
any other suggestion?

thanks.

I hope i made it clear enough
